Fees for MBBS in Italy for Indian students normally cost anywhere between €500 and €5,000 each year in public universities. The total cost per year for pursuing MBBS from Italy for Indian candidates, consisting of all costs such as fees, hostel accommodation, etc., usually ranges between ₹7 lakh and ₹15 lakh.

MBBS in Italy Fees and Living Expenses
The major benefit associated with studying MBBS in Italy is cost-effectiveness, because tuition costs are based on the university chosen and the financial status of the family, since many state universities use the ISEE indicator for calculating costs.
Estimated Tuition Fees
Expense | Annual Cost |
Tuition Fees | €500–€5,000 |
Hostel/Accommodation | €3,000–€6,000 |
Food | €2,000–€3,000 |
Transportation | €300–€600 |
Health Insurance | €150–€250 |
Miscellaneous | €1,000–€2,000 |
Consequently, the total MBBS in Italy cost for the year varies from €7,000 to €15,000, including all living costs.
The MBBS in Italy for Indian students fees continue to be amongst the cheapest in all of Europe, thanks to the government-subsidized universities.
MBBS in Italy for Indian Students Fees in Rupees
According to exchange rates prevailing today (subject to change):
Expense | Approximate Cost (INR) |
Tuition Fees | ₹50,000–₹5,00,000/year |
Living Expenses | ₹6–10 lakh/year |
Total Annual Cost | ₹7–15 lakh |

Eligibility and How to Apply for MBBS in Italy
Knowing how to apply for MBBS in Italy becomes important to get admission into the medical course.
Eligibility Requirements
Students normally require:
- Class 12 examination passed in Physics, Chemistry, and Biology
- Qualifying minimum marks for each university
- NEET certificate (for Indian students planning to practice in India)
- Passport
- English language competency (when necessary)
Admission Process
- Research universities that offer Medicine in English.
- Register for the IMAT exam.
- Attend the IMAT.
- Apply via the university’s admissions portal.
- Confirmation of admission.
- Apply for an Italian student visa.
- Make arrangements for accommodation and travel.
This is a very competitive process and early preparation is important.
MBBS in Italy Scholarship Opportunities
Financial aid is a key factor that attracts students from other countries. Some universities, as well as some regions, offer MBBS in Italy scholarships for financially needy students and for those who excel academically.
Some famous scholarship programs include the following:
- DSU Regional Scholarship
- Lazio Disco Scholarship
- EDISU Scholarship
- Merit Scholarships by Universities
- Italian Scholarships by Government
Scholarships may cover:
- Tuition fee waiver
- Free accommodation
- Monthly stipend
- Meal allowances
- Study materials
These funding opportunities significantly reduce the cost of MBBS in Italy for Indian students, making medical education highly affordable.

Is the MBBS course in Italy acknowledged in India for international students?
Yes, the MBBS in Italy for international students can be pursued at universities that are certified by WHO and NMC (National Medical Commission). Indian students need to clear the NEET before taking admission to such universities and also satisfy the license requirements set by NMC.
